Hexo站点地图生成器:hexo-generator-sitemap插件使用指南
需积分: 16 97 浏览量
更新于2024-11-13
收藏 10KB ZIP 举报
资源摘要信息:"hexo-generator-sitemap:Hexo的站点地图生成器"
知识点详细说明:
1. Hexo站点地图生成器:
Hexo是一个快速、简洁且功能强大的静态网站生成器,它支持Markdown语言,非常适合用于搭建个人博客。站点地图对于搜索引擎优化(SEO)非常重要,它能够帮助搜索引擎快速发现网站上的所有页面。hexo-generator-sitemap插件正是为了生成符合SEO标准的站点地图而设计的。
2. 安装过程:
使用npm安装hexo-generator-sitemap插件是非常简单的过程。通过npm命令行工具,执行以下命令即可安装:
```
$ npm install hexo-generator-sitemap --save
```
安装后,插件会自动注册到Hexo中,无需进行额外的配置步骤。
3. 插件版本兼容性:
插件兼容不同版本的Hexo,具体为:
- Hexo 4版本支持2.x版本的插件
- Hexo 3版本支持1.x版本的插件
- Hexo 2版本支持0.x版本的插件
4. 配置选项:
用户可以在Hexo的配置文件_config.yml中对hexo-generator-sitemap插件进行个性化配置。以下是一些可用的配置项及其说明:
- `path`: 站点地图文件的路径,默认为sitemap.xml。
- `template`: 自定义模板文件的路径,用于生成sitemap.xml文件。用户可以自行定义XML模板,以符合特定的需要。
- `rel`: 是否在网站标题中添加rel属性,默认为false。
- `tags`: 是否在站点地图中添加网站标签,默认为true。
- `categories`: 是否在站点地图中添加网站类别,默认为true。
5. 排除特定帖子或页面:
用户可以通过在帖子或页面的front-matter中添加配置项来排除它们不被加入到站点地图中,例如:
```
sitemap:
exclude: true
```
通过这种方式,可以灵活控制站点地图的内容。
6. Hexo与JavaScript的关系:
Hexo作为静态网站生成器,本身并非直接使用JavaScript,但是它通过npm进行插件管理,而npm是Node.js的包管理器,Node.js是一种使用JavaScript运行在服务器端的平台。因此,Hexo插件开发大多会用到JavaScript语言,特别是Node.js环境下的JavaScript。
7. 插件资源文件:
文件名称列表中提及的“hexo-generator-sitemap-master”表明这是该插件的源代码文件夹名称。作为源代码包,它包含了插件的主要功能代码、文档和可能的示例配置文件等资源,用户可以通过这些资源了解插件的工作原理和使用方法。
总结来说,hexo-generator-sitemap插件为Hexo博客提供了一种生成和管理站点地图的简便方式,使得网站内容能够更好地被搜索引擎索引。同时,通过配置文件和模板的自定义,用户可以控制站点地图的具体内容和格式,以满足个性化的需求。作为静态网站生成器的扩展插件,它依赖于Node.js平台下的JavaScript进行开发,方便了网站的SEO优化和内容管理。
2019-08-29 上传
2020-06-22 上传
2021-05-25 上传
2021-02-21 上传
2021-03-23 上传
2021-02-13 上传
2021-03-16 上传
2021-03-23 上传
2021-02-12 上传
jacknrose
- 粉丝: 26
- 资源: 4542
最新资源
- R语言中workflows包的建模工作流程解析
- Vue统计工具项目配置与开发指南
- 基于Spearman相关性的协同过滤推荐引擎分析
- Git基础教程:掌握版本控制精髓
- RISCBoy: 探索开源便携游戏机的设计与实现
- iOS截图功能案例:TKImageView源码分析
- knowhow-shell: 基于脚本自动化作业的完整tty解释器
- 2011版Flash幻灯片管理系统:多格式图片支持
- Khuli-Hawa计划:城市空气质量与噪音水平记录
- D3-charts:轻松定制笛卡尔图表与动态更新功能
- 红酒品质数据集深度分析与应用
- BlueUtils: 经典蓝牙操作全流程封装库的介绍
- Typeout:简化文本到HTML的转换工具介绍与使用
- LeetCode动态规划面试题494解法精讲
- Android开发中RxJava与Retrofit的网络请求封装实践
- React-Webpack沙箱环境搭建与配置指南